Free cupcakes tomorrow in Portsmouth, New Hampshire

9f1e31e3232c16 o 150x112 Free cupcakes tomorrow in Portsmouth, New Hampshire

Seacost Online brings news of free cupcakes tomororw, November 7th, from 1 pm to 4 pm at The Old Stove Bake Shoppe in Portsmouth, New Hampshire! Plus what fun flavors they are debuting… The shop will introduce four new gourmet cupcake flavors: candy corn, death by chocolate, salted caramel and monkey bread. Two hundred customers will receive free their choice of one of the four new flavors on a first-come, first-served basis. There is a limit of one per person. “It fits with our style,” Mugherini said of the new cupcakes. “We’re always making up new flavors. It makes people smile when they see candy corn or monkey bread.” Mugherini’s personal favorite, monkey bread, is similar to the traditional cinnamon pastry, but with a cream cheese frosting. The candy corn cupcakes are made of a light butterscotch cake with vanilla buttercream colored orange, yellow and white. Death by chocolate is made with dark chocolate cake with mini chocolate chips, decorated with a dark chocolate buttercream with a chocolate drizzle. Raspberry Mousse Tartlets with a Chocolate Surprise

14f66ef172e pie2.jpg Raspberry Mousse Tartlets with a Chocolate Surprise

 I had a really stressful week. When I was talking about it to my friend K, she suggested two things. Go over to her place for dinner. Or make something decadent and post it on my blog. (Notice how both involve food?!). I went with option two. What can be more stress busting than cooking (and then making S clean up)? What can make a girl happier than a luscious raspberry mouse tart with dark chocolate ganache hidden inside?! And what can make me forget my worries that reading your comments Stress be gone!  You can whip up this dessert rather quickly because there is no baking involved. The only time consuming step is chilling the tartlets for atleast 3 hours so that the filling sets.   I used store bought graham cracker mini tarts. You can use whatever pie crust you like. An oreo crust will be great too.  The filling is raspberry jello powder or agar agar, mixed with a quick raspberry jam (recipe below), cream cheese and cream. Whip everything together. Pour a little chocolate ganache at the bottom of the pie/tart. Then pour the raspberry mousse in and let it set. Chewy Chocolate chip cookies – dark chocolate and cranberry and white chocolate and macadamia

f2b53f4b76f19d6a 112x150 Chewy Chocolate chip cookies – dark chocolate and cranberry and white chocolate and macadamia

1 and a half cups of plain flour 1/2 to 3/4 cup cocoa powder 1 tsp baking soda 1/2 tsp salt cup brown sugar firmly packed 1/2 cup castor sugar 175 grams of butter (room temperature – but still firm) 1 egg and 1 egg yolk beaten 100 grams chocolate chunks 100 grams chocolate chips 50 grams dried cranberries Heat oven to 160degrees and place rack in bottom 3rd of the oven – mine is just below the middle. Cream butter and sugar on slow for about 3 mins do not overbeat – I read it makes a difference! Add the beaten egg and yolk and beat till combined again but once combined stop. I have read that overbeating may affect the mixture so I stopped when I considered that the additions were combined well in. Sift plain flour, cocoa, salt, baking soda together and add to this mixture to the creamed butter, sugar and eggs and on slow combine. With a wooden spoon stir in chocolate and cranberries.
